NGA Report on Rural Economic Development and the Arts

The National Governors Association (NGA) has published a report, entitled "Strengthening Rural Economies through the Arts," which shows how rural communities benefit economically from having arts organizations work in their area. Based on the findings, NGA recommends that the arts industry be integrated into state development planning, and that more money is invested in rural cultural recourses.
